Virginia Governor Will Not Stay Sniper Execution
New York Times
WASHINGTON — Gov. Tim Kaine said Tuesday that he would not stay tonight's scheduled execution of John Allen Muhammad, the man dubbed the “DC Sniper” whose murderous shooting spree in the Fall of 2002 left at least 10 dead.
